BEST VEGETARIAN BAKED ZITI



BEST Vegetarian Baked Ziti image

This recipe is all you need to make an all-star vegetarian baked ziti with ricotta, marinara sauce, and a layer of bright veggies. Perfect weeknight baked pasta, and you can prepare it ahead and store in the fridge or freezer for later. See notes.

Provided by Suzy Karadsheh

Categories     Entree

Time 55m

Number Of Ingredients 14

3/4 lb Ziti or Penne pasta
Extra virgin olive oil (I used Early Harvest Greek extra virgin olive oil)
1 medium red onion, chopped
2 zucchini, small diced
1 bell pepper (orange or red), cored and diced
2 garlic cloves, minced
Kosher salt
1 tsp dry oregano
1/2 tsp sweet paprika
6 cups quality Marinara sauce (store-bought is fine)
10 basil leaves, torn or carefully sliced/chopped
1 cup ricotta (I used part-skim)
1/2 cup grated Parmesan, divided
6 oz shredded Mozzarella

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 375 degrees F.
  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. When ready, add the pasta and cook to al dante according to package. When ready, drain pasta but save about 1/2 cup cooking water.
  • While the pasta is cooking , cook the vegetables. In a large skillet, heat 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il over medium heat until shimmering but not smoking. Add onions and cook for 3 minutes or so, tossing regularly, then add diced zucchini, bell pepper, and garlic. Raise heat to medium-high and cook for about 6 to 8 minutes, tossing regularly, until vegetables have softened and cooked through. Season with kosher salt, oregano and paprika. Sit aside till needed.
  • In a mixing bowl, combine the ricotta, 1/4 cup grated Paremsan and 3 tbsp Mozzarella. Mix well. (If needed, add a drizzle of extra virgin olive oil to help mix the cheese)
  • Once the pasta has been cooked and drained, bring it back to the cooking pot. Add 1/2 of the marinara sauce and starchy cooking water you reserved (1/2 cup). Mix well to coat the pasta with the sauce. Fold in the ricotta cheese filling. Mix again to combine, but leave some big "pockets" of the cheese mixture.
  • Grab a 9 1/2" x 13" casserole dish. Pour a little marinara sauce to the bottom of the dish, spread. Spread half the pasta. Now add the cooked vegetables and some of the torn basil on top and spread well across the pasta layer. Sprinkle a little bit of shredded mozzarella on top (leave more mozzarella for very top layer.) Add remaining pasta. Spread remaining marinara sauce on top and add remaining mozzarella cheese and Parmesan cheese.
  • Place the casserole dish on the middle rack of your heated oven. Bake uncovered for 30 minutes or so. Remove from heat and let rest about 10 to 15 minutes before cutting through. garnish with fresh basil.

BAKED ZITI WITH ROASTED VEGETABLES



Baked Ziti with Roasted Vegetables image

This amazing baked ziti recipe is lightened up with roasted vegetables. Golden mozzarella, sizzling red sauce and tender pasta make this vegetarian ziti super delicious! Recipe yields 8 servings.

Provided by Cookie and Kate

Categories     Main dish

Time 1h20m

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 medium head of cauliflower, cut into bite-sized florets
1 red bell pepper, cut into 1″ squares
1 medium yellow onion, sliced into wedges about ½″ wide
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, divided
1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t, divided
8 ounces ziti, rigatoni or penne pasta
4 cups (32 ounces) marinara sauce (homemade or store-bought), divided
1/4 cup chopped fresh basil, plus extra for garnish
8 ounces (2 packed cups) grated part-skim mozzarella cheese, divided
2 cups (16 ounces) cottage cheese or ricotta cheese, divided

Steps:

  • To roast the veggies: Preheat the oven to 425 degrees Fahrenheit with racks in the middle and upper third of the oven. Line two large, rimmed baking sheets with parchment paper to prevent the vegetables from sticking.
  • Place the cauliflower florets on one pan. On the other pan, combine the bell peppers and onion. Drizzle half of the olive oil over one pan, and the other half over the other pan. Sprinkle the salt over the two pans. Gently toss until the vegetables on each pan are lightly coated in oil.
  • Arrange the vegetables in an even layer across each pan. Bake until the vegetables are tender and caramelized on the edges, about 30 to 35 minutes, tossing the veggies and swapping their rack positions halfway (lower rack to upper rack, and vice versa). Leave the oven on at 425, because we're going to bake the dish at the same temperature. If you end up with any stray burnt onion pieces, discard them, and set the vegetables aside.
  • Meanwhile, bring a large pot of salted water to boil. Cook the pasta just until al dente, according to package directions (it will continue to cook while it bakes in the oven, so you want the pasta to still have a little bite to it). Drain and return the pasta to the pot.
  • Add 2 cups of the marinara, the chopped basil, and 1/2 cup of the mozzarella to the pasta. Gently stir to combine.
  • It's assembly time! Spread 1 cup of additional marinara sauce inside a 9×13″ baker. Top with half of the pasta mixture, and gently spread it into an even layer. Evenly sprinkle the roasted cauliflower on top, then dollop 1 cup of the cottage cheese over the cauliflower (it doesn't need to be spread into an even layer), followed by 1/2 cup of the mozzarella.
  • Top the mozzarella with the remaining pasta. Then sprinkle the roasted peppers and onion on top, dollop the remaining cup of ricotta on top, then dollop the remaining cup of marinara on that, then sprinkle the remaining cheese all over.
  • Place a clean, rimmed baking sheet on the lower oven rack to catch any drippings. Place the ziti, uncovered, on top of the baking sheet. Bake for 30 minutes, then transfer to the upper rack for 2 to 5 more minutes until the cheese is deeply golden, if desired.
  • Remove the baker from the oven and let it cool for 10 minutes before serving (trust me). Sprinkle freshly torn basil on top, slice with a sharp knife, and serve.

ZITI ALFREDO WITH VEGETABLES



Ziti Alfredo with Vegetables image

"A creamy dressing, lots of flavor an unexpected hint of nutmeg make this hearty pasta dish so delicious i can't resist fixing it often," relates Emma Magielda of Amsterdam, New York.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 25m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 medium onion, ch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
2 teaspoons olive oil
8 ounces uncooked ziti or small tube pasta
2 tablespoons butter
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 cup fat-free milk
1-1/2 cups fat-free half-and-half
1 cup shredded Parmesan cheese
2 teaspoons Italian seasoning
1/4 teaspoon salt
Dash white pepper
Dash ground nutmeg
1 can (14-1/2 ounces) Italian diced tomatoes, drained
1 package (10 ounces) frozen chopped spinach, thawed and squeezed dry

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an, saute onion and garlic in oil until tender; set aside. Cook ziti according to package directions. Meanwhile, in a large saucepan, melt butter; stir in flour until smooth. Reduce heat; slowly add milk. , Stir in half-and-half. Bring to a boil over medium-low heat;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Reduce heat; add the Parmesan cheese, Italian seasoning, salt, pepper and nutmeg. Stir until cheese is melted. , Add the tomatoes, spinach and onion mixture; heat through. Drain the ziti; toss with vegetable mixture.

ROASTED VEGETABLE BAKED ZITI



Roasted Vegetable Baked Ziti image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h45m

Yield 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

2 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ons flour
2 cups vegetable stock
1 medium onion, poked with a fork
3 tablespoons Parmesan cheese
Salt and pepper
2 pounds plum tomatoes, seeded, quartered
2 medium Italian eggplant, quartered, sliced
2 large red bell peppers, seeded, quartered
1 large Spanish onion, halved, cut into eighths
4 cloves garlic, chopped
1/4 cup calamata olives, pitted, sliced
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 pound ziti pasta, cooked al dente, drained
1 pound mozzarella cheese, sliced thin
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at broiler. Make sauce: In a saucepan, melt butter. Stir in flour and cook, whisking about 2 minutes. Stir in vegetable stock, a little bit at a time. Add onion and Parmesan cook until the thickness you would like. Remove onion. Set aside. In a roasting pan arrange tomatoes, eggplant, red peppers, onion and toss with garlic, olives and oil. Place pan in the oven on the top shelf for 30 minutes or until vegetables are beginning to brown. Remove from oven to a cutting board and roughly chop all the vegetables. Transfer them to a bowl. Preheat oven to 375 degrees F. Ladle about 1/3 of sauce on the bottom of a 9 by 13-inch pan. Layer 1/2 of vegetables, 1/2 cooked pasta, 1/2 of mozzarella, 1/2 pasta, 1/3 sauce, 1/2 mozzarella, 1/2 vegetables, 1/3 sauce, Parmesan. Bake, covered with foil, for approximately 35 minutes. Remove foil and bake for 10 minutes more or until bubbly.

ZITI WITH SKILLET-ROASTED ROOT VEGETABLES



Ziti with Skillet-Roasted Root Vegetables image

Provided by Bon Appétit Test Kitchen

Categories     Pasta     Roast     Christmas     Dinner     Beet     Parsnip     Sweet Potato/Yam     Winter     Potluck     Bon Appétit     Vegetarian     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ons olive oil
2 1/2 cups coarsely chopped red onion
2 cups 1/2-inch pieces peeled parsnips
2 cups 1/2-inch pieces peeled redskinned sweet potatoes (yams)
2 cups 1/2-inch pieces peeled golden beets, greens coarsely chopped and reserved
1 tablespoon chopped fresh rosemary
1 2/3 cups (about) vegetable broth, divided
1 pound ziti or other tubular pasta
2 tablespoons (1/4 stick) butter
1 1/2 cups grated Parmesan cheese, divided

Steps:

  • Heat oil in large nonstick skillet over high heat. Add onion and all vegetables except beet greens; sauté until vegetables begin to soften and brown, 8 to 9 minutes. Add rosemary; stir 1 minute. Add 1 cup broth; bring to boil. Reduce heat to medium; sprinkle with salt and pepper. Cover skillet and cook until vegetables are tender, stirring occasionally, 15 to 18 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, cook pasta in large pot of boiling salted water until just tender but still firm to bite, stirring occasionally. Drain. Return pasta to pot.
  • Stir beet greens and butter into vegetables; add to pasta. Stir in 1 cup Parmesan and more vegetable broth by 1/3 cupfuls to moisten. Season with salt and pepper. Serve with remaining Parmesan.

VEGETARIAN BAKED ZITI



Vegetarian Baked Ziti image

Baked ziti is one of our family favorites; I developed this to serve at dinner when a good friend who is a vegetarian comes over.

Provided by HisHouseCook

Categories     Pasta and Noodles     Pasta by Shape Recipes

Time 1h25m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 15

cooking spray
2 tablespoons olive oil
2 cups cubed eggplant
2 cups cubed zucchini
2 large tomatoes, chopped
1 medium red bell pepper, cubed
1 medium onion, chopped
3 cloves garlic, minced, or more to taste
2 teaspoons Italian seasoning
1 teaspoon salt
1 (16 ounce) package ziti pasta
1 (32 ounce) jar spaghetti sauce
1 (15 ounce) can Italian-style diced tomatoes
½ cup non-dairy Parmesan cheese substitute
1 (16 ounce) package sliced fresh mozzarella c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Spray a 3-quart baking dish with cooking spray.
  • Heat oil in a large saute pan over medium heat. Add eggplant, zucchini, tomatoes, bell pepper, onion, and garlic; cook, stirring occasionally until vegetables are tender, about 10 minutes. Sprinkle with Italian seasoning and salt; stir to combined.
  • Meanwhile, b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Add ziti and cook, stirring occasionally, until tender yet firm to the bite, about 11 minutes. Drain and rinse in cold water.
  • Mix spaghetti sauce and diced tomatoes together in a medium bowl.
  • Spread 1/3 of the sauce mixture in the bottom of the prepared casserole. Layer ingredients as follows: 1/2 of the ziti, 1/2 of the vegetable mixture, 1/2 of the Parmesan substitute, 1/2 of the mozzarella slices, 1/2 of the remaining sauce, all of the remaining ziti, all of the remaining vegetables, all of the remaining Parmesan substitute, and all of the remaining sauce. Set remaining mozzarella slices aside.
  • Cover loosely and bake in the preheated oven until bubbly, 25 to 30 minutes. Remove from the oven, uncover, and top with remaining mozzarella slices. Return to the oven and bake, uncovered, until cheese is melted and slightly browned, 10 to 15 minutes longer.

ROASTED VEGETABLE ZITI BAKE



Roasted Vegetable Ziti Bake image

This fresh-tasting and well-seasoned entree is a real crowd-pleaser. "I combine roasted vegetables, zesty sauce and just the right touch of melted cheese to create this pasta dish that's deliciously filling," says Helen Carpenter from her home in Albuquerque, New Mexico

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 1h20m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 21

1 pound eggplant, peeled and cut into 1-inch cubes
1 large red onion, cut into 1-inch pieces
2 medium sweet yellow peppers, cut into 1-inch pieces
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/2 teaspoon salt
SAUCE:
1-1/2 cups chopped onions
2 teaspoons olive oil
6 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
1/2 teaspoon fennel seed, crushed
1 can (28 ounces) crushed tomatoes
1 can (14-1/2 ounces) diced tomatoes, undrained
1/4 cup minced fresh parsley
1-1/4 teaspoons sal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
1/4 teaspoon sugar
1/8 teaspoon dried thyme
1 package (16 ounces) ziti or other small tube pasta
4 cups chopped fresh spinach
1 cup sh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ese

Steps:

  • In a 15x10x1-in. baking pan coated with cooking spray, combine the eggplant, red onion and yellow peppers. Drizzle with oil; sprinkle with salt. Bake, uncovered, at 400° for 35-45 minutes or until edges of peppers begin to brown, stirring every 10 minutes., Meanwhile, in a saucepan, saute onions in oil until tender. Add garlic, red pepper flakes and fennel; cook and stir for 1 minute. Add the tomatoes, parsley, salt, pepper, sugar and thyme.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 15 minutes. Cook pasta according to package directions; drain., In two greased 2-qt. baking dishes, spread 1/2 cup sauce each. In each dish, layer a fourth of the pasta, a fourth of the roasted vegetables and 1/2 cup sauce. Top with 2 cups spinach and 1/2 cup sauce. Top with remaining roasted vegetables, pasta and sauce. , Cover and bake at 350° for 30 minutes. Uncover; sprinkle with cheese. Bake 10-15 minutes longer or until heated through and cheese is melted.

VEGETARIAN ITALIAN BAKED ZITI



Vegetarian Italian Baked Ziti image

A long simmered sauce with mushrooms and vegetables flavors this rich, meatless Italian dish. Don't let the cook time fool you--while the sauce is simmering and the ziti is baking, you can relax!

Provided by laura

Categories     Pasta and Noodles     Pasta by Shape Recipes

Time 3h40m

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 18

2 tablespoons olive oil
3 large portobello mushroom caps, chopped
1 medium white onion, chopped
1 medium bell pepper, chopped
2 stalks celery, diced
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 (28 ounce) jar meatless spaghetti sauce
2 large tomatoes, chopped
1 tablespoon minced fresh Italian parsley
1 ½ teaspoons dried oregano
1 teaspoon dried basil
½ (16 ounce) package ziti pasta
2 cups cottage cheese
1 cup shredded fresh mozzarella cheese
¾ cup non-dairy Parmesan cheese substitute
1 large egg, slightly beaten
½ te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Heat olive oil in a 12-inch skillet over medium-high heat. Add mushrooms, onion, bell pepper, celery, and garlic; saute until tender, 5 to 7 minutes. Stir in spaghetti sauce, tomatoes, parsley, 1 teaspoon oregano, and basil. Cover, reduce heat, and simmer for 2 hours.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Oil a 9x13-inch baking pan.
  • Just before the sauce is finished, b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Add ziti and cook, stirring occasionally, until tender yet firm to the bite, about 11 minutes. Drain.
  • Combine cottage cheese, mozzarella cheese, 1/2 of the Parmesan substitute, egg, salt, and pepper in a bowl. Mix remaining Parmesan substitute and 1/2 teaspoon oregano in another small bowl.
  • Spread 1 cup sauce in the bottom of the prepared pan. Layer 1/3 cup ziti, 1 cup sauce, and 1/3 cottage cheese mixture; repeat layers twice more. Top with any remaining sauce, then sprinkle with oregano-Parmesan blend.
  • Cover with foil and bake in the preheated oven until bubbly, about 1 hour.
